2012 CLP to YER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2012

During 2012, the CLP to YER ex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on February 9, valuing the pair at 0.4589.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on May 31, dropping to 0.4126.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0463 YER.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.4368 to the December average rate of 0.4503, the exchange rate registered a net change of 3.10%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2012 high of 0.4589 was down 2.74% compared to the 2011 peak of 0.4718,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
